1 definition found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Varec \Var"ec\, n. [F. varech; of Teutonic origin. See {Wrack} seaweed, wreck.] The calcined ashes of any coarse seaweed used for the manufacture of soda and iodine; also, the seaweed itself; fucus; wrack. [1913 Webster]
